Bill Summary

AN ACT in relation to authorizing the commissioner of education to conduct a study on incorporated nonpublic schools in the state; and to amend the education law, in relation to nonpublic school compliance with instruction requirements

AI Summary

This bill directs the Commissioner of Education to conduct a study on all incorporated nonpublic schools in the state, including those that are currently operating or have applied for incorporation but have not yet been approved. The study will gather information such as the number of schools, their names, incorporation status (religious, non-profit, or for-profit), total enrollment, grade levels offered, location, and registration with the State Education Department. Additionally, the bill amends the Education Law to allow the Commissioner to recognize and approve accreditation agencies for the purpose of fulfilling the instructional requirements for nonpublic elementary and high schools, which would be deemed in compliance if accredited or in provisional status by an approved agency.
